chore: 更新 .env.example 文件

This commit is contained in:
Del 2024-06-03 10:35:11 +08:00
parent 5ff8771b47
commit d91d514a46
4 changed files with 13 additions and 17 deletions

View File

@ -1,18 +1,14 @@
# Mi Services
MI_USER="小米账号"
MI_PASS="账号密码"
MI_DID="小爱音箱设备 ID 或在米家 APP 种设置的设备名称"
# OpenAI
# OpenAI也支持通义千问、MoonShot、DeepSeek 等模型参数)
OPENAI_MODEL=gpt-4o
OPENAI_API_KEY=sk-xxxxxxxxxxxxxxx
OPENAI_BASE_URL=https://api.openai.com/v1
# 提示音效(可选)
# AUDIO_SILENT=静音音频链接
# AUDIO_BEEP=默认提示音链接
# AUDIO_ACTIVE=唤醒提示音链接
# AUDIO_ERROR=出错了提示音链接
# 提示音效(可选,一般不用填,你也可以换上自己的提示音链接试试看效果)
# AUDIO_SILENT=静音音频链接示例https://example.com/slient.wav
# AUDIO_BEEP=默认提示音链接,同上
# AUDIO_ACTIVE=唤醒提示音链接,同上
# AUDIO_ERROR=出错了提示音链接,同上
# Doubao TTS可选
# Doubao TTS可选,用于调用第三方 TTS 服务,比如:豆包
# TTS_DOUBAO=豆包 TTS 接口
# SPEAKERS_DOUBAO=豆包 TTS 音色列表接口

View File

@ -63,9 +63,9 @@ import { MiGPT } from "mi-gpt";
async function main() {
const client = MiGPT.create({
speaker: {
userId: process.env.MI_USER,
password: process.env.MI_PASS,
did: process.env.MI_DID,
userId: "944123456", // 注意:不是手机号或邮箱,请在「个人信息」-「小米 ID」查看
password: "123456", // 账号密码
did: "小爱音箱Pro", // 小爱音箱 ID 或在米家中设置的名称
},
});
await client.start();

View File

@ -81,7 +81,7 @@ export class BaseSpeaker {
playingCommand,
ttsCommand = [5, 1],
wakeUpCommand = [5, 3],
audioBeep = process.env.audioBeep,
audioBeep = process.env.AUDIO_BEEP,
} = config;
this.debug = debug;
this.audioBeep = audioBeep;

View File

@ -55,7 +55,7 @@ export class Speaker extends BaseSpeaker {
const {
heartbeat = 1000,
exitKeepAliveAfter = 30,
audioSilent = process.env.audioSilent,
audioSilent = process.env.AUDIO_SILENT,
} = config;
this.audioSilent = audioSilent;
this._commands = config.commands ?? [];